Cowpat,

This is all the Info I have on them.

They are going to be operating 2 x 752er's from STN - JFK in an all Club Class config at around £1800. They have slots ex UK at 15:00z & 19:00z with only 2 acft. They will be operating under the Air 2000 AOC presumably for ETOPS but they will not be using AMM Equipment. They will be operating under a different name as Newline is just a working title.

It's Swiss money, the Sales Director is Niel Mott ex AA, the Chief Engineer if thats what he's called is Kieth Lutton ex FD. They are looking to commence ops on or around the 1/5/01. They will operate in to T3 at JFK and have even sorted out lounges. The only thing they appear short of is acft, but, Mr Luttons searching right now.

Thier 75's will be config'd at 80 Club class seats with an onboard business & communications centre. They've aimed their slots at the end of a working day in each city.
